Start with taking a stroll.

Walk around your home, looking closely at things like your driveway, walkway and your home itself. Look for signs of damage or wear and tear, and repair what you can.

Mending cracks and gaps in sidewalks and walkways with a patching compound made specifically for cement (available at home improvement stores) for example with not only stop them from cracking further but make the pathways safer and much nicer to look at!

With just a screwdriver and a few minutes, giving your front door a facelift with new, updated house numbers can give your entryway new life. With many designs and fonts available, this makes for a practical, attractive update that not only looks good, but readable numbers make delivery folks lives much easier!

Take a look at your home, itself. How does the paint/siding look? Paint and siding both protect your home’s very “bones” from the elements. If there are only a few spots here and there, it should be relatively easy to patch up. If it’s obvious you need a new paint job, don’t put it off too long, or like many other problems, it could end up costing you much more in the long run!

Finally, looking at your roof from the ground can give you quite of bit of information about the status of your roof. If you can see missing, curled or loose shingles from the ground or debris in the gutters, this could indicate larger problems. If you see anything amiss calling a roof contractor for  free estimate/inspection can go a log way at catching a problem early before it costs a fortune.
